当前位置:首页 / EXCEL

Excel粘贴源格式怎么做?如何保留格式粘贴?

作者:佚名|分类:EXCEL|浏览:90|发布时间:2025-04-16 21:42:45

Excel粘贴源格式怎么做?如何保留格式粘贴?

在Excel中,粘贴数据时保留原始格式是一个常见的需求。无论是从其他工作表、工作簿还是外部文件粘贴数据,保留格式可以大大提高工作效率。以下是一些详细的方法和步骤,帮助您在Excel中实现保留格式粘贴。

一、使用“粘贴特殊”功能

1. 选择粘贴区域:首先,在Excel中选中您想要粘贴数据的目标区域。

2. 粘贴数据:将数据从源处复制或剪切,然后粘贴到目标区域。

3. 打开“粘贴特殊”对话框:在粘贴后,点击“粘贴”按钮旁边的下拉箭头,选择“粘贴特殊”。

4. 选择格式:在弹出的“粘贴特殊”对话框中,选择“格式”选项,然后点击“确定”。

5. 完成粘贴:此时,粘贴的数据将保留源格式。

二、使用快捷键

1. 选择粘贴区域:与上述步骤相同,先选中目标区域。

2. 粘贴数据:复制或剪切数据,然后粘贴到目标区域。

3. 使用快捷键:在粘贴后,按下`Ctrl`+`Alt`+`V`组合键,打开“粘贴特殊”对话框。

4. 选择格式:在“粘贴特殊”对话框中选择“格式”,然后点击“确定”。

5. 保留格式:数据将按照源格式粘贴。

三、使用“选择性粘贴”

1. 选择粘贴区域:选中目标区域。

2. 粘贴数据:复制或剪切数据,然后粘贴到目标区域。

3. 打开“选择性粘贴”对话框:在粘贴后,点击“粘贴”按钮旁边的下拉箭头,选择“选择性粘贴”。

4. 选择格式:在弹出的“选择性粘贴”对话框中,勾选“格式”选项,然后点击“确定”。

5. 保留格式:数据将保留源格式。

四、使用VBA宏

如果您经常需要粘贴格式,可以使用VBA宏来自动化这个过程。

1. 打开VBA编辑器:按下`Alt`+`F11`组合键打开VBA编辑器。

2. 插入新模块:在VBA编辑器中,右键点击“VBAProject(你的工作簿名称)”,选择“插入”>“模块”,插入一个新的模块。

3. 编写宏代码:在模块中输入以下代码:

```vba

Sub PasteFormat()

With Selection

.PasteSpecial Paste:=xlPasteFormats

Application.CutCopyMode = False

End With

End Sub

```

4. 运行宏:关闭VBA编辑器,回到Excel,按下`Alt`+`F8`组合键,选择“PasteFormat”,然后点击“运行”。

五、注意事项

在使用上述方法时,确保源数据格式是正确的,否则粘贴后的格式可能不理想。

如果源数据包含复杂的格式,如条件格式、数据验证等,粘贴后可能需要手动调整。

相关问答

1. 为什么粘贴后格式丢失了?

答:可能是因为在粘贴时没有选择保留格式,或者源数据格式不兼容。

2. 如何粘贴图片格式?

答:在“粘贴特殊”或“选择性粘贴”对话框中,选择“图片”选项,然后点击“确定”。

3. 如何粘贴公式而不粘贴格式?

答:在“粘贴特殊”或“选择性粘贴”对话框中,选择“公式”选项,然后点击“确定”。

4. 如何粘贴格式而不粘贴数据?

答:在“粘贴特殊”或“选择性粘贴”对话框中,选择“格式”选项,然后点击“确定”。

通过以上方法,您可以在Excel中轻松实现保留格式粘贴,提高工作效率。


参考内容:https://game.yqkyqc.cn/soft/89.html